Hardware Platform Engineer - Data Center Systems & Rack Integration
Job Description
As compute density and cooling complexity increase, OCI depends on hardware platforms that are both innovative and deployable at scale. This role ensures new designs are consistent, practical, and ready for global deployment.
Responsibilities
Key Responsibilities
Hardware Platform Development & Integration
-
Lead integration of rack-level hardware platforms for data center deployment
-
Ensure designs meet requirements for mechanical integrity, thermal performance, serviceability, and scale
-
Drive system-level design across compute, cooling, and infrastructure interfaces
-
Partner with internal and external teams to validate designs
Data Center Interface & Deployment Readiness
-
Define platform interfaces with infrastructure, including:
-
Liquid cooling (CDUs, fluid routing, connections)
-
Installation, transport, and handling
-
Facility interfaces (space, power, cooling, serviceability)
-
Ensure deployment readiness and resolve gaps impacting scale
Telemetry & Observability
-
Define telemetry requirements (power, temperature, flow, pressure, system health)
-
Ensure instrumentation is enabled at deployment
-
Partner with software/data teams to support monitoring and analysis
-
Identify and close gaps in telemetry coverage and data quality
Standards & Documentation
-
Drive standardization across rack platforms
-
Establish best practices for connections, transport, leak detection, and instrumentation
-
Maintain documentation as a source of truth
Cross-Functional Leadership
-
Collaborate across OHD, engineering, operations, supply chain, and software teams
-
Align with external partners (OEMs, silicon vendors)
-
Drive technical decisions and bring structure to complex efforts
Issue Resolution & Continuous Improvement
-
Track and resolve platform issues, especially during early deployment
-
Lead root cause analysis and corrective actions
-
Use field data and telemetry insights to improve designs and processes
Required Qualifications
-
Bachelor's degree in Mechanical Engineering or closely related discipline
-
6+ years in hardware engineering, mechanical systems, or data center infrastructure
-
Experience with complex, rack- or system-level hardware
-
Strong foundation in mechanical, thermal, and/or fluid systems
-
Experience with hardware instrumentation/telemetry is a plus
-
Proven ability to drive outcomes across teams
-
Strong problem-solving and communication skills
Preferred Qualifications
-
Data center infrastructure and rack-level design experience
-
Familiarity with liquid cooling (e.g., direct-to-chip, CDU systems)
-
Experience with platform standardization or system integration at scale
-
Experience working with hardware vendors or OEMs
-
Exposure to high-density compute platforms (e.g., GPUs)
-
Experience supporting deployment or commissioning
-
Familiarity with telemetry or performance monitoring systems
